* James Alexander Williamson (1886–1964) was a prominent English writer on maritime history and expert on the John Cabot voyages. He also wrote many other books on explorers, exploration and discovery. James Williamson wrote of James Cook: the greatest explorer of his age and the greatest maritime explorer of his country in any age.
* The James Ford Lectures in British History are a prestigious annual series at Oxford University funded by James Ford (1779–1851), a Trinity College, Oxford alumnus, former Fellow (1807–1830), and antiquarian. Established in 1896, they feature distinguished historians presenting original research
